Effects of tree nut and groundnut consumption compared with those of l-arginine supplementation on fasting and postprandial flow-mediated vasodilation: Meta-analysis of human randomized controlled trials.

What this study found

Longer-term tree nut and groundnut intake and L-arginine supplementation both improved fasting flow-mediated dilation, and the nut effect could not be fully explained by L-arginine content. Tree nut/groundnut consumption increased fasting FMD by 1.09 PP (95% CI 0.49, 1.69; P < 0.001), while L-arginine increased fasting FMD by 0.53 PP (95% CI 0.12, 0.93; P = 0.012); the difference between fasting effects was not significant (P = 0.31). Study & population
Systematic review and meta-analysis of human randomized controlled trials assessing brachial artery flow-mediated dilation after tree nut/groundnut consumption or L-arginine supplementation.
Intervention
Tree nuts and groundnuts were consumed as dietary interventions, usually 15 to 128 g/day for 4 weeks to 6 months, often as part of an energy- and/or fat-matched substitution diet; postprandial studies used fixed nut-containing meals.
Key limitation
Substantial heterogeneity was present across pooled analyses, and the included trials varied widely in population, dose, duration, and comparator diets.
